What the Wyoming data shows for Licensed Professional Counselors

To practice as a licensed professional counselor in Wyoming, the state licensing board requires 2,554 documented education or training hours, a passing score on NCE (National Counselor Exam) or NCMHCE, and 2 years of supervised work experience. A criminal history background check is also part of the application. Applicants must be at least 18 years old. The regulation sits under Wyoming's professional licensing framework, which classifies the training track as "Masters Degree in Counseling".

Upfront cost is $70, with renewal running $68 on a 2-year cycle. The license also carries an ongoing 30-hour continuing-education requirement per 2-year cycle that adds to the true cost of staying licensed.

Reciprocity for this profession works like this: Counseling Compact: 40+ states.
